Last edited by Gdawg1007 (April 23, 2024 19:40:03) WebPart 1: Installing a .hex file on your micro:bit 1. Plug your micro:bit into your computer. Connect the small end of the USB cable to the micro USB port on your BBC micro:bit Connect the other end of the USB cable to a USB port on your computer. You should see the micro:bit appear on your computer.
WebMonitor and control. The 'Monitor and control' section of the iOS app allows you to observe real-time data from the micro:bit sensors, send messages directly to the LEDs and control the micro:bit buttons and pins from your iPad or iPhone. Monitor is also ideal for exploring Bluetooth services in real-time, and for debugging your program code. In the bottom left-hand corner of the screen, below the block ... udemy on fire tabletWebJan 18, 2024 · Universal Hex Format The editors and apps are compatible with and will let you download and flash a file to any micro:bit revision. This is called a Universal Hex file. A clear indication that you are working with this format is that a compiled .hex file will be ~1.8Mb as opposed to ~700Kb in size. udemy one note classes
